Transaction 51c1bda8d406491a91b84ffacadc2fbfb99921939f248a930c52dd4b08cb44f5
1 Input
1 Output
-
51c1bda8d406491a91b84ffacadc2fbfb99921939f248a930c52dd4b08cb44f5:0
- value
- 83730
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e6faa40d8ade0ca9eac385cded2b49a5bf02ecf3 OP_EQUAL
- address
- 3NkKbVfYyZFYPKH6H5CdtKN7scPsqf5mxx